What is the "Calc is Short for Calculator" Meme?

The "calc is short for calculator" meme is a piece of internet humor that playfully mocks the overly literal and sometimes nonsensical way people abbreviate words. It highlights the tendency for some abbreviations to be so obvious or redundant that they become humorous. The meme often uses a fabricated "calculator" to assign absurd scores to these abbreviations, satirizing the very act of calculation and abbreviation.

At its core, the meme pokes fun at pedantry and the internet's love for obscure jokes. It's not about actual mathematical calculations but rather the *idea* of calculation applied to language in a ridiculous way. Anyone who appreciates wordplay, internet culture, or enjoys a good, silly joke can engage with this meme.

A common misunderstanding is that there's a complex algorithm behind these memes. In reality, the humor comes from the *simplicity* and *obviousness* of the "rule" being applied, often in contrast to a more complex or subjective concept like "calculating meme potential." It's the juxtaposition of a serious-looking "calculator" with a trivial subject that creates the comedic effect. For instance, the idea that "calc" needs a "calculator" to determine its abbreviation is inherently absurd.
